What is x and y? 2x-2y=-4 2x+y=11 Is there infinitely many solutions, 1 solution, or no solution? solve by elimination.

Answers

Let's solve your system by substitution.

2x−2y=−4;2x+y=11

Rewrite equations:

2x+y=11;2x−2y=−4

Step: Solve2x+y=11for y:

2x+y=11

2x+y+−2x=11+−2x(Add -2x to both sides)

y=−2x+11

Step: Substitute−2x+11foryin2x−2y=−4:

2x−2y=−4

2x−2(−2x+11)=−4

6x−22=−4(Simplify both sides of the equation)

6x−22+22=−4+22(Add 22 to both sides)

6x=18

6x/6 = 18/6

(Divide both sides by 6)

x=3

Step: Substitute3forxiny=−2x+11:

y=−2x+11

y=(−2)(3)+11

y=5(Simplify both sides of the equation)

Answer:

x=3 and y=5

On average yasmin drinks 3/4 of an 8 ounce glass of water in 1 1/4 hours how much can she drink per hour

Answers

Answer:

She drinks 4.8 ounces of water per hour

Step-by-step explanation:

We know

Yasmin drank 3/4 of an 8-ounce glass of water in 1 1/4 hours

3/4 of 8 ounce = 6 ounces

1 1/4 = 5/4 = 1.25 hours

How much can she drink per hour?

6 divided by 1.25 = 4.8 ounces of water per hour

So, she drinks 4.8 ounces of water per hour.

Adult tickets for a charity concert were $5 each. Students were admitted for $2 each. The charity concert
sold 700 tickets and made $3050. How many students attended the lecture?

Answers

Answer:

students 150

adult 550

Step-by-step explanation:

x + y = 700

5x + 2y = 3050

x = 700 - y

5(700 - y) + 2y = 3050

3500 - 5y + 2y = 3050

-3y + 3500 = 3050

-3y = 3050 - 3500

-3y = -450

y = -450 / -3

y = 150

x = 700 - y

x = 700 - 150

x = 550

a monthly fee for twenty-four months to use its facilities. Six months later, after reaching the age of majority, Janice continues to use the club. This act is

Answers

The act of continuing to use the club is contract affirmation or performance. This is because of the agreement with the club to pay a monthly fee for 24 months. When Janice reached the age of majority, she had the option of rejecting the contract, which would mean that she would no longer have to pay the monthly fee.

However, since she continued to use the club six months later after reaching the age of majority, she has effectively affirmed the contract by her actions. Janice's act of continuing to use the club is an example of contract affirmation or performance. Contract affirmation is when one party confirms or accepts the terms of a contract by words, conduct or behavior. It is also known as contract performance.Contract affirmation is common in situations where one party has the option to terminate the contract but continues to perform the obligations under the agreement. In this case, Janice had the option to terminate the contract after reaching the age of majority but chose to continue using the club. This action shows that she has accepted the terms of the contract and is willing to fulfill her obligations under the agreement.In conclusion, Janice's act of continuing to use the club six months after reaching the age of majority is an example of contract affirmation or performance. It shows that she has accepted the terms of the contract and is willing to continue to fulfill her obligations under the agreement.

Does this graph show a function? Explain how you know.

Does this graph show a function? Explain how you know.

Answers

Answer:

No, the graph fails the vertical line test

Step-by-step explanation:

To determine if the graph is a function, we can use the vertical line test.

Use a vertical line, if the vertical passes through two or more points, the graph is not a function

Looking at the y axis ( which is a vertical line), it passes through two points

This means the graph is not a function

No, the graph fails the vertical line test
